With a lowpass filter, frequencies above the cutoff frequencyDefinition:
The filter frequency where the response is down 3 dB compared to the frequency (or range of frequencies) where response is at maximum. With a lowpass filter, frequencies above the cutoff frequency become progressively more attenuated.
